Sixth Anchor Handler Delivered to CBO

Friday, November 2, 2018
CBO Terra Brasilis (Photo: Grupo CBO)

Brazilian shipping company Grupo CBO has taken delivery of the final vessel in a series of six Brazilian-built anchor-handlers.

The half dozen anchor-handling vessels are of the Havyard 843 design by Norway's Havyard Design & Solutions, which developed the design specially for Brazilian conditions to offer greater width and deck capacity.

Havyard signed the initial design contract for the first four vessels in 2014 and a further two in 2016, marking the design firm's first contract in South America and its largest ever individual order.

The six vessels were built and delivered by a Brazilian shipyard.

Norwegian Control Systems AS – which is also part of the Havyard Group  – delivered navigation and communication equipment and complete electrical engineering services for the newbuilds.
